About Food 4 Education
Hungry kids can’t learn or grow.

Food4Education is an award-winning, locally rooted, and African-led solution to end classroom hunger.
Building on more than a decade of learning by doing, we’re powering a new school feeding industry and
sharing our blueprint to scale sustainable, nutritious, and affordable school feeding programs across
Africa.

Today, we serve 600,000 kids DAILY in Kenya. But every day, we deliver more than a meal – improving
nutrition and education outcomes for children while also creating jobs and opportunities for whole
communities.

We are an experienced and trusted non-profit partner that operates with the excellence of a global
business, reinvesting the value we create into local economies.

Role Overview
We are seeking a detail-oriented and proactive Junior Laboratory Associate to support the
delivery of high-quality food safety testing services. This role will focus on microbiological and
basic chemical analysis of food, water, and food contact surfaces to ensure compliance with
internal and regulatory standards. The ideal candidate will thrive in a fast-paced laboratory
setting and contribute to continuous improvement and operational excellence.

Key Responsibilities
● Sample Collection & Handling

  • Collect samples (food, water, surface swabs) from centralized and decentralized sites across Kenya.
  • Receive, register, label, store, and dispose of samples in line with approved procedures.

● Laboratory Testing & Analysis

  • Conduct microbiological testing, including enumeration and detection of foodborne pathogens.
  • Perform routine chemical analyses as required.
  • Ensure accuracy, repeatability, and compliance with established methods.

● Documentation & Quality Management

  • Maintain accurate, up-to-date laboratory records and test reports.
  • Support the development, review, and implementation of Standard Operating
  • Procedures (SOPs) and Work Instructions.
  • Participate in proficiency testing, internal audits, and inter-laboratory comparisons.

● Equipment & Inventory Management

  • Operate, clean, calibrate, and maintain laboratory equipment.
  • Monitor and manage inventory of reagents, consumables, PPE, and glassware.
  • Flag low stock and coordinate timely replenishment.

● Compliance & Housekeeping

  • Adhere to safety protocols and Good Laboratory Practices (GLP).
  • Ensure compliance with ISO 17025:2017 quality standards.
  • Maintain a clean and organized laboratory environment.

● Team Contribution

  • Participate in self-inspections and continuous improvement initiatives.
  • Perform other duties as assigned by the line manager.

Desired Candidate Profile
● Bachelor’s Degree in Microbiology, Food Science or related course.
● At least 2 years of hands-on experience in an ISO 17025:2017 testing laboratory.
● Familiarity with microbial analysis techniques, especially in food and beverage
contexts.
● Strong documentation and organizational skills.
● Proficient in Microsoft Office Suite (Excel, Word) and basic laboratory data systems.
